Limited-time deal: Suzuki announces Fronx discount

Fronx discount

Pak Suzuki has raised the prices of its Suzuki Fronx hybrid models, however just hours after the change, they updated the prices again after putting up a limited-time promotional offer on the new price.

The company had earlier jacked up the price of the Fronx GLX 6A/T Mono Tone from Rs6,299,999 to Rs7,000,000 and the Two Tone variant from Rs6,374,999 to Rs7,075,000. Later, Pak Suzuki announced special promotions on these revised prices.

The Mono Tone version now sells at Rs6,700,000 with the Two Tone version at Rs6,775,000.

VariantPrevious PriceRevised PriceLimited-Time Offer Price
Fronx GLX 6A/T Mono ToneRs6,299,999Rs7,000,000Rs6,700,000
Fronx GLX 6A/T Two ToneRs6,374,999Rs7,075,000Rs6,775,000

Although the latest announcement may appear to be a price cut, customers are still paying more than before.

The company initially raised prices by Rs700,000 and then cut down Rs300,000 in the promotional offer, resulting in the net increase of Rs400,000 over the original prices.

The offer is for the updated prices only and does not result in a reset of the vehicles’ prices.

This means that buyers will be able to make use of the discount for a brief time but still end up paying quite a bit more than they did prior to the adjustment.

Pak Suzuki has yet to announce when the promotion will close.

The company only said they would have a limited special offer for a limited number of units in the announcement, so it’s possible the sales could be limited by the stock on hand or by the period of the offer.
